Access Denied

You don't have permission to access "http://www.zarahome.cn/cn/%E6%9B%B4%E8%A1%A3%E5%AE%A4/%E5%B8%86%E5%B8%83%E5%92%8C%E7%9A%AE%E9%9D%A9%E6%94%B6%E7%BA%B3%E7%9B%92-c1020412356p305744341.html" on this server.

Reference #18.544e4e68.1711704626.cdd190c

https://errors.edgesuite.net/18.544e4e68.1711704626.cdd190c